我正在尝试使用sshfs在我的虚拟Linux机器上安装Amazon Web服务器ec2实例的驱动器。
我使用的命令如下:
sameeksha@technician:~$ sudo sshfs -i $HOME/Downloads/amazonkey.pem [email protected]:/var/www $HOME/Documents
我得到的错误是:
fuse: invalid argument `/home/sameeksha/Documents'
我试图找到问题,但是使用 fuse 时只能发现此错误。但是我什至没有在这里使用 fuse 。使用相同的命令,我可以将驱动器安装到系统上。但是这次奇怪的是它抛出了这个错误。
请分享您的看法。
谢谢。
最佳答案
我遇到了这个问题(也使用ec2实例),在这里找到了答案:https://www.chrisnewland.com/solved-sshfs-with-private-key-what-is-the-syntax-262
sshfs作为参数与ssh不同。您需要的是:
sudo sshfs -o IdentityFile=$HOME/Downloads/amazonkey.pem [email protected]:/var/www $HOME/Documents